Heat Advisory issued July 24 at 12:00PM CDT until July 25 at 9:00PM CDT by NWS Norman OK

Details

* WHAT…For the first Heat Advisory, heat index values up to 106
expected. For the second Heat Advisory, heat index values up to 108
expected.

* WHERE…Portions of central, northwest, southeast, southern,
southwest, and western Oklahoma and northern Texas.

* WHEN…For the first Heat Advisory, until 8 PM CDT this evening.
For the second Heat Advisory, from 11 AM to 9 PM CDT Saturday.

* IMPACTS…Hot temperatures and high humidity may cause heat
illnesses.

Instructions

Drink plenty of fluids, stay in an air-conditioned room, stay out of
the sun, and check up on relatives and neighbors.

Take extra precautions when outside. Wear lightweight and loose
fitting clothing. Try to limit strenuous activities to early morning
or evening. Take action when you see symptoms of heat exhaustion and
heat stroke.
